Record a discussion once. It's distilled into Knowledge Bubbles — your team's shared memory. The next time anyone primes a coding session, that context flows in. The session itself is captured back to the Ledger, so the next coworker inherits it too. Context compounds instead of evaporating.
Works with your coding agent
ox is agent-agnostic. The same recorded context is primed into, and queryable from, whichever agent your team uses.
| Agent | Prime context | Record sessions | What fires it | |---|:---:|:---:|---| | Claude Code | ✅ | ✅ | hooks — session, prompt, tool, and compaction | | Codex CLI | ✅ | ✅ | hooks — session, prompt, and tool | | Gemini CLI | ✅ | ✅ | hooks — tool and stop | | Droid | ✅ | ✅ | hooks — tool and stop | | OpenCode | ✅ | ✅ | plugin — session start | | Amp | ✅ | ✅ | plugin records; AGENTS.md primes | | Pi | ✅ | ✅ | AGENTS.md | | Aider | ✅ | ✅ | CONVENTIONS.md | | Goose | ✅ | ✅ | hooks — session, prompt, tool, and tool-failure | | Cursor · Windsurf · Cline · Copilot · Kiro | ✅ | ➖ | instruction file |
✅ shipped · ➖ planned. Claude Code is the primary, most-tested target; see agent compatibility for the per-agent detail.
ox query, ox murmur, and ox status are plain CLI commands. They work from any agent — including ones with no adapter — as long as ox is on PATH.
Orchestrators
ox also detects the harness running your agents, and adapts what it tells them:
- Block Buzz — spawns agents through its
buzz-acp ACP harness
· OpenClaw
Detection is config-independent — ox walks the process ancestry rather than trusting an environment variable, so it works even when the harness sets nothing. Under Buzz, ox agent prime emits an extra directive: buzz-acp does not fire the agent lifecycle hooks that push whispers into a turn, so the agent is told to pull teammates' signals by hand instead of silently missing them.

How it works
ox init writes a .sageox/ directory that ties the repo to your team. From then on, ox agent prime injects team context — conventions, security requirements, architectural decisions, prior sessions — into each AI coworker before it writes a line. Coworkers, human and AI, share that context through the Team Context and the per-repo Ledger.
The payoff is multiplayer by default. When a discussion, an implementation session, and the resulting code all carry the same shared context, a reviewer opening the PR has the full story — the original reasoning, the session that built it, and the diff — without chasing anyone down.
